  • - Isetan Department Store
  • In the morning we visit the iconic Isetan department store, which has the highest sales per day worldwide! The store is often first with showcasing new trends and products, in particular, the fashion and food floors are thought to be very trendsetting. The history of the department store began as early as 1886.

  • - NEWoMan Galleria & Takashimaya Department Store
  • Our next stop will be the NEWoMan galleria, located by the Shinjuku Station. It is tailored towards the modern woman and offers quality fashion, restaurants, cafes, beauty and lifestyle brands. To serve users of the Shinjuku Station, they offer not only pharmacies, but licensed nurseries, as well as pediatric, gynecological, and other specialized clinics.   • - Dinner at a local Izakaya restaurant
  • Izakayas are essentially Japanese taverns – drinking houses with a menu of small dishes for snacking while drinking. It literally means “stay sake shop” so traditionally this was a place where you could sit and drink on the premises.
